0

だから私はいくつかの異なる場所でこれを調べました.私が見た唯一の答えは「span.sIFR-alternate要素をスタイルする」です. 問題は、実際に表示されて正しく配置されるスタイルをその要素に適用すると、FlashBlock が存在しない場合 (Safari/IE など) または無効になっている場合に sIFR テキストと一緒に表示されることです。

のデフォルトのスタイルは次の.sIFR-alternateとおりです。

.sIFR-alternate {
    position: absolute;
    left: 0;
    top: 0;
    width: 0;
    height: 0;
    display: block;
    overflow: hidden;
}

そして、私はこれらを追加しています:

span.sIFR-alternate {
    font-family: Helvetica, Arial, sans-serif;
    text-transform: uppercase;
    font-size: 24px;
    line-height: 14px;
    color: #000000;
    padding: 0;
    margin-top:12px;
    margin-bottom:7px;
}

私は何が欠けていますか?

そうでなければ、sIFR はうまく機能しています。

4

1 に答える 1

0

本気ですか?それはまったく足し合わない。他のスタイル プロパティをプロパティごとに追加して、何がそれをトリガーするかを確認してください。

于 2010-04-10T20:40:53.240 に答える